What is Supply Chain Management (SCM)?
SCM is the planning, coordination, and management of sourcing, procurement, production, and logistics activities among suppliers, service providers, and customers to deliver value efficiently across the supply chain.
How is logistics defined in relation to SCM?
Logistics is a component of SCM that focuses on planning, implementing, and controlling the efficient flow and storage of goods, services, and information, managing both forward and reverse flows between the point of origin and the point of consumption.
What is the trade-off between effectiveness and efficiency in SCM?
Improving customer service levels (effectiveness) often increases costs, while reducing costs (efficiency) can negatively affect customer service, requiring a balance between the two.
What is the definition of lead time?
The total time it takes from when an order is placed until delivery.
What is the difference between efficiency and effectiveness?
Efficiency is about achieving a goal with as little waste of resources as possible, while effectiveness is about achieving the goal as much as possible.
What does the Customer Order Decoupling Point (CODP) indicate?
The CODP indicates how far upstream in a supply chain's production or distribution process a customer order penetrates.
What is CODP1 (Make to stock - Local)?
A strategy where the CODP is at the very end of the logistics chain, closest to the customer, often applied to consumer goods such as those in Lidl or Aldi.
What is CODP3 (Assemble to order)?
A strategy where raw materials and semi-finished products are kept in stock, which the customer can freely combine into a finished product, such as Dell computers.
What is CODP5 (Purchase and make to order)?
A variant where no inventory is kept, and the purchase of raw materials and components begins only after the customer order is received, such as an "ideal bike to size."
